Who was Kim II Sung?
katovenus [111]
<span>Kim Il-sung was the supreme leader of North Korea (Democratic People's Republic of Korea) From 1948 to his death is 1994</span>

In the juvenile justice system, where is the emphasis?
mezya [45]

Answer:

Rehabilitation and reintegration

Explanation:

It's built around skill development, rehabilitation, addressing treatment needs, and re-introducing the youth back into the community so that when they start living in the community again, they have a clear purpose and they know what they want to be and are willing to put in the work to get there.
